Transaction 38e01103196e4870cb41e07042c03622bd39adea21a144c3594476a705270f7f

1 Input
2 Outputs
  • 38e01103196e4870cb41e07042c03622bd39adea21a144c3594476a705270f7f:0
  • value  924038
    address  bc1qgjf3kzn6kryxnqes7w7yrkuwumf04z9lta4qlc
  • 38e01103196e4870cb41e07042c03622bd39adea21a144c3594476a705270f7f:1
  • value  24898528
    address  3BMEXYYrYaZSsYLP5DgE9XcFotyWVeoYzS